Background
The abrasive material of the sand blasting machine impacts and cuts the surface of a workpiece, so that the surface of the workpiece obtains certain cleanliness and different roughness, the mechanical property of the surface of the workpiece is improved, impurities and an oxide layer on the surface are removed, and the metal workpiece is polished and derusted.
In the sand blasting machine field, the part sand blasting machine that uses at present can not play the guard action when carrying out rust cleaning work to metal work piece, the phenomenon that the people was hurt in the sandblast spray appears easily, and can not collect the smoke and dust that produces when removing rust, thereby can bring harm to operational environment and staff's health, part sand blasting machine is not convenient for adjust the angle of shower nozzle when using in addition, thereby can not remove the rust to metal work piece and part special-shaped workpiece of variation in size, greatly reduced sand blasting machine's application scope, therefore, put forward a rust cleaning device for metal product processing to above-mentioned problem.

The model of the sand blasting machine 3 is a PANFOOK sand blasting machine, the model of the fan 6 is a DF5 fan, the model of the first motor 13 is a 775 motor, the model of the second motor 17 is a Y90S-4 motor, and the model of the controller 20 is a 900U controller.
The working process is as follows: when the device is used, the controller 20 controls the second motor 17 to rotate one hundred eighty degrees, the gear 18 is meshed with the rack 19, the fixing frame 5 drives the baffle 16 and the limiting block 15 to slide rightwards, then a metal workpiece to be derusted is placed on the top end face of the fixing frame 5 to be positioned between the limiting block 15 and the baffle 16, finally the controller 20 controls the second motor 17 to continuously rotate one hundred eighty degrees, all components are reset to initial positions, the controller 20 starts the device after the above operations are completed, the sand blasting machine 3 performs sand blasting derusting work on the metal workpiece through the spray head 10, then the handle 12 is rotated, the spray head 10 is controlled to rotate through the fixing block 11, the components are completely derusted, then the controller 20 controls the first motor 13 to drive the threaded shaft 14 to slowly rotate, thereby cooperate the rotation of slider 4 and handle 12 to be connected, the screwed connection of slider 4 and threaded shaft 14 and the sliding connection of fixed block 11 and second handle 12 drive shower nozzle 10 and the removal of fixed block 11 position around going on, thereby rust cleaning is carried out to the metal work piece of different positions and the special-shaped metal work piece of variation in size, in the in-process that metal work piece was derusted, fan 6 also can pull the smoke and dust that produces and get into in collection box 8 through trachea 7, thereby filter the smoke and dust through filter screen 9, at last be collected in collection box 8, the phenomenon that the smoke and dust scatters and endanger operational environment and staff's health has been avoided.
